Rogue wave

a obscure independent alternative/psychedilic rock band from California. The combine complex, relaxed guitar melodies with laid back lyrics. The result is music that is throuroughly enjoyable, while remaining relaxing.

The are associated with Sub Pop records.

wave goodbye

To wave to someone as you leave.

Mom often would wave goodbye as we left for school.
